Disgraceful customer service. Two garments took nearly one month to arrive, when they arrived, they were of poor quality and were not cheap to purchase. When asked where they were being delivered from, I was told ' overseas ' and told they did not have any control or way of tracking or checking on delivery times! clearly from China. I clearly… Read more
thought this company operated out of Australia given the name; ' Lily Melbourne ' I chose to return the items for a full refund; I was provided with an address in China to which I had to incur the postage cost and told once the items arrived at that destination I would be refunded. when tracking the parcel from Australia after not receiving a refund after 2 months (in this time I could see the parcel was just sitting somewhere in China customs, then only to be returned to my address!) There has been numerous emails back & forth still without resolution. Lily Melbourne is now only offering a 40% refund stating again that they have no control or take no responsibility for this issue. Regretful that I didn't look at the reviews before purchasing these items as I can see this appears to be a common occurrence. Extremely disappointed and hoping this does not continue to happen to other shoppers.

100 per cent, DO NOT PURCHASE FROM LILLY MELBOURNE Drop shippers from ASIA , headquarters based in the Eu Amsterdam , nothing to do with Melbourne Australia ,They’ll give you a pretty good run around once you receive your item and see what absolute rubbish it is. They will offer you a discounted refund to keep the item, or a 50 percent of… Read more
purchase price gift voucher to spend on more rubbish , Or you can post it back to them in 'ASIA' at your expense. All this despite their claim of Free Refunds if you are unsatisfied for any reason . Beware of the sister websites offering similar services also.
I have now had my full payment refunded from PayPal buyers protection team . No further contact was made by LILY MELBOURNE
